repo.or.cz
/
qemu
/
ar7.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
target-i386/machine: fix migrate faile because of Hyper-V HV_X64_MSR_VP_RUNTIME
2016-10-26
Emilio G
.
C
ot
a
target-arm: remove EXC
P
_ST
R
EX +
c
p
u_exclusive_{test
.
.
.
Signed-off-by:
Emilio G. Cota
<cota@braap.org>
commit
|
commitdiff
|
tree
2016-10-26
Emil
i
o
G
.
Cota
linux-us
e
r:
r
emove
h
and
l
ing of aarch6
4
's EXCP_STRE
X
Signed-off-by:
Emilio G. Cota
<cota@braap.org>
commit
|
commitdiff
|
tree
2016-10-26
Emilio G
.
Cota
linux-user
:
remove handling of ARM
'
s EXCP_STREX
Signed-off-by:
Emilio G. Cota
<cota@braap.org>
commit
|
commitdiff
|
tree
2016-10-26
Emi
l
i
o
G
.
Cota
tar
g
et
-
a
rm: emula
t
e a
a
rch
6
4's LL/SC us
i
ng cmpxc
h
g help
e
rs
Signed-off-by:
Emilio G. Cota
<cota@braap.org>
commit
|
commitdiff
|
tree
2016-10-26
Emilio G
.
Cota
target-
a
rm
:
e
m
ulate SWP with atomi
c
_xchg helpe
r
Signed-off-by:
Emilio G. Cota
<cota@braap.org>
commit
|
commitdiff
|
tree
2016-10-26
Emilio G
.
Cota
target-arm: emulate LL/SC
using cmpxchg helpers
Signed-off-by:
Emilio G. Cota
<cota@braap.org>
commit
|
commitdiff
|
tree
2016-10-26
Em
i
lio G
.
Cota
tests: add atomic_a
d
d-be
n
ch
Signed-off-by:
Emilio G. Cota
<cota@braap.org>
commit
|
commitdiff
|
tree
2016-10-26
E
mil
i
o G
.
Cot
a
target-i38
6
:
re
m
ove helper_lock()
Signed-off-by:
Emilio G. Cota
<cota@braap.org>
commit
|
commitdiff
|
tree
2016-10-26
Emilio G
.
Cota
t
arget-i38
6
:
emulate XCHG using
ato
m
i
c h
e
lper
Signed-off-by:
Emilio G. Cota
<cota@braap.org>
commit
|
commitdiff
|
tree
2016-10-26
Emilio G
.
Cota
targe
t
-i3
8
6
:
emula
t
e LOCK'ed BTX ops using ato
m
ic helpers
Signed-off-by:
Emilio G. Cota
<cota@braap.org>
commit
|
commitdiff
|
tree
2016-10-26
Emi
l
io G
.
Cota
target-i386
:
e
mulate L
O
CK'ed XA
D
D using atomic helper
Signed-off-by:
Emilio G. Cota
<cota@braap.org>
commit
|
commitdiff
|
tree
2016-10-26
Emili
o
G
.
Cota
ta
r
get-i386
:
emulate LOC
K
'ed
NEG usi
n
g
cmpxchg help
e
r
Signed-off-by:
Emilio G. Cota
<cota@braap.org>
commit
|
commitdiff
|
tree
2016-10-26
Emilio G
.
Co
t
a
target-i386:
e
mu
l
ate LO
C
K'ed NOT using
a
tomic helper
Signed-off-by:
Emilio G. Cota
<cota@braap.org>
commit
|
commitdiff
|
tree
2016-10-26
Emil
i
o
G
.
Cota
t
a
r
get-i386: emu
l
at
e
LOCK'ed
I
NC using atomic helper
Signed-off-by:
Emilio G. Cota
<cota@braap.org>
commit
|
commitdiff
|
tree
2016-10-26
E
mili
o
G
.
Co
t
a
targe
t
-i386: emulate LOCK'ed OP inst
r
u
c
t
ions using
.
.
.
Signed-off-by:
Emilio G. Cota
<cota@braap.org>
commit
|
commitdiff
|
tree
2016-10-26
Emi
l
io G
.
Cot
a
t
arget-i3
8
6: emulate LOCK'ed
cmpxchg
using
cmpxchg
.
.
.
Signed-off-by:
Emilio G. Cota
<cota@braap.org>
commit
|
commitdiff
|
tree
2016-10-26
E
m
i
l
io G
.
Cota
atomics: add atomic_op_fetc
h
v
ariants
Signed-off-by:
Emilio G. Cota
<cota@braap.org>
commit
|
commitdiff
|
tree
2016-10-26
Emilio G
.
Cota
a
t
o
m
ics: add a
t
om
i
c_
x
or
Signed-off-by:
Emilio G. Cota
<cota@braap.org>
commit
|
commitdiff
|
tree
2016-10-24
E
m
i
l
io G
.
C
ota
qht-be
n
ch: relax test_start/stop atom
i
c accesses
Signed-off-by:
Emilio G. Cota
<cota@braap.org>
commit
|
commitdiff
|
tree
2016-10-06
Emil
i
o G
.
C
ota
test-qht: perform lookups under rcu
_
read_l
o
ck
Signed-off-by:
Emilio G. Cota
<cota@braap.org>
commit
|
commitdiff
|
tree
2016-10-06
Emilio
G
.
Cota
qht: fix unlock-aft
e
r-fre
e
s
egfault upon resizi
n
g
Signed-off-by:
Emilio G. Cota
<cota@braap.org>
commit
|
commitdiff
|
tree
2016-10-06
Em
i
lio G
.
Cota
qht: si
m
plify qht
_
reset_size
Signed-off-by:
Emilio G. Cota
<cota@braap.org>
commit
|
commitdiff
|
tree
2016-08-03
Emilio G
.
Cota
qdist: return "(empty)
"
instea
d
o
f
NULL when pr
i
nting
.
.
.
Signed-off-by:
Emilio G. Cota
<cota@braap.org>
commit
|
commitdiff
|
tree
2016-08-03
Emilio G
.
Cota
qdist: use g_renew
a
nd g_new ins
t
ead of
g
_
r
ealloc a
n
d
.
.
.
Signed-off-by:
Emilio G. Cota
<cota@braap.org>
commit
|
commitdiff
|
tree
2016-08-02
Emilio G
.
C
ota
qdist: fix
m
emory leak during binning
Signed-off-by:
Emilio G. Cota
<cota@braap.org>
commit
|
commitdiff
|
tree
2016-08-02
Emilio G
.
Co
t
a
qht: do not segfault when gathering stats
f
rom an
u
ninit
i
a
li
.
.
.
Signed-off-by:
Emilio G. Cota
<cota@braap.org>
commit
|
commitdiff
|
tree
2016-06-12
Em
i
lio G
.
Cota
t
ransl
a
te-all: add tb ha
s
h
b
ucket info to
'info
j
it
.
.
.
Signed-off-by:
Emilio G. Cota
<cota@braap.org>
commit
|
commitdiff
|
tree
2016-06-12
Emilio G
.
C
ota
tb
h
as
h
:
t
rack translated bl
o
c
k
s wit
h
qht
Signed-off-by:
Emilio G. Cota
<cota@braap.org>
commit
|
commitdiff
|
tree
2016-06-12
Emilio G
.
Cota
q
h
t
: add te
s
t-qh
t
-
p
a
r t
o
i
n
v
oke qh
t
-benc
h
from 'check
.
.
.
Signed-off-by:
Emilio G. Cota
<cota@braap.org>
commit
|
commitdiff
|
tree
2016-06-12
Emilio G
.
Cota
q
ht: ad
d
q
ht-bench, a performance benc
h
mar
k
Signed-off-by:
Emilio G. Cota
<cota@braap.org>
commit
|
commitdiff
|
tree
2016-06-11
Emilio G
.
Cota
qht: add te
s
t program
Signed-off-by:
Emilio G. Cota
<cota@braap.org>
commit
|
commitdiff
|
tree
2016-06-11
Emi
l
i
o
G
.
Cota
q
h
t: QE
M
U's f
a
st
,
resizable a
n
d sca
l
able Hash Table
Signed-off-by:
Emilio G. Cota
<cota@braap.org>
commit
|
commitdiff
|
tree
2016-06-11
Emilio G
.
Cota
q
dist: add test program
Signed-off-by:
Emilio G. Cota
<cota@braap.org>
commit
|
commitdiff
|
tree
2016-06-11
Emilio G
.
C
o
ta
qdist
:
add module to represent frequen
c
y d
i
s
t
ributi
o
n
s
.
.
.
Signed-off-by:
Emilio G. Cota
<cota@braap.org>
commit
|
commitdiff
|
tree
2016-06-11
Emilio G
.
Cota
tb
h
ash:
h
ash phy
s
_p
c
, pc, and flags
with xxhash
Signed-off-by:
Emilio G. Cota
<cota@braap.org>
commit
|
commitdiff
|
tree
2016-06-11
Em
i
lio G
.
Cot
a
exec:
a
dd tb_ha
s
h_func5, derived from x
x
hash
Signed-off-by:
Emilio G. Cota
<cota@braap.org>
commit
|
commitdiff
|
tree
2016-06-11
Emilio G
.
Cota
in
c
lude/processor
.
h: defi
n
e cpu_relax(
)
Signed-off-by:
Emilio G. Cota
<cota@braap.org>
commit
|
commitdiff
|
tree
2016-06-11
Emilio G
.
C
ota
seqloc
k
:
rename wri
t
e_l
o
ck/u
n
l
ock to w
r
ite_
b
egi
n
/
e
n
d
Signed-off-by:
Emilio G. Cota
<cota@braap.org>
commit
|
commitdiff
|
tree
2016-06-11
Em
i
l
io G
.
Cota
seqlock: remove optional mut
e
x
Signed-off-by:
Emilio G. Cota
<cota@braap.org>
commit
|
commitdiff
|
tree
2016-06-11
Emilio G
.
Cota
comp
i
ler
.
h:
ad
d
QEMU_ALIGNED() to enforce struct alig
n
ment
Signed-off-by:
Emilio G. Cota
<cota@braap.org>
commit
|
commitdiff
|
tree
2016-05-29
Emilio G
.
Cota
atom
i
cs: d
o
not emit
c
onsume barrier for atomic_rcu_re
a
d
Signed-off-by:
Emilio G. Cota
<cota@braap.org>
commit
|
commitdiff
|
tree
2016-05-29
Emilio G
.
C
ota
atomics: emi
t
an
s
mp_r
e
a
d_b
a
rrier_de
p
ends() bar
r
ier
.
.
.
Signed-off-by:
Emilio G. Cota
<cota@braap.org>
commit
|
commitdiff
|
tree
2016-05-29
Emil
i
o
G
.
C
o
ta
docs/atomics: update at
o
mic_read/set c
o
mparison
with
.
.
.
Signed-off-by:
Emilio G. Cota
<cota@braap.org>
commit
|
commitdiff
|
tree
2016-05-13
Emilio G
.
Cota
translate-all: add
missing
m
unmap of
t
he code_g
e
n guard
.
.
.
Signed-off-by:
Emilio G. Cota
<cota@braap.org>
commit
|
commitdiff
|
tree
2016-05-13
Emilio G
.
Cota
t
r
anslate
-
all
:
re
m
ove redundant setting of tcg_ctx
.
.
.
Signed-off-by:
Emilio G. Cota
<cota@braap.org>
commit
|
commitdiff
|
tree
2016-05-13
Emilio
G
.
Cota
tb
:
consistently u
s
e
uint
3
2
_
t for tb->flags
Signed-off-by:
Emilio G. Cota
<cota@braap.org>
commit
|
commitdiff
|
tree
2016-04-07
Emilio
G
.
C
ota
tr
a
n
s
l
ate-all: add m
i
ssing
f
o
l
d of tb_ctx into t
c
g
_
c
t
x
Signed-off-by:
Emilio G. Cota
<cota@braap.org>
commit
|
commitdiff
|
tree
2015-09-09
E
milio G
.
Cota
translat
e
-a
l
l
:
remove obs
o
l
e
te comment about l
1
_map
Signed-off-by:
Emilio G. Cota
<cota@braap.org>
commit
|
commitdiff
|
tree
2015-09-09
E
m
i
l
i
o G
.
Cota
linux-user: call rcu_(un)register_thread on pthread_
.
.
.
Signed-off-by:
Emilio G. Cota
<cota@braap.org>
commit
|
commitdiff
|
tree
2015-09-09
Emilio
G
.
Cota
r
c
u: fix comment
w
i
th s/r
c
u_g
p
_lock/rcu_r
e
gistry_lock/
Signed-off-by:
Emilio G. Cota
<cota@braap.org>
commit
|
commitdiff
|
tree
2015-09-09
E
m
ilio
G
.
Cota
rcu: init
r
cu_
r
egistry
_
lock after fork
Signed-off-by:
Emilio G. Cota
<cota@braap.org>
commit
|
commitdiff
|
tree
2015-09-07
Emilio
G
.
Cota
seqlock: read sequence number atomically
Signed-off-by:
Emilio G. Cota
<cota@braap.org>
commit
|
commitdiff
|
tree
2015-09-07
Emilio G
.
Cota
seql
o
ck: ad
d
missi
n
g 'in
l
ine' to seqlock
_
read
_
retry
Signed-off-by:
Emilio G. Cota
<cota@braap.org>
commit
|
commitdiff
|
tree
2015-09-02
Em
i
l
io G
.
Cota
qemu-thread: handle
s
purious fu
t
ex_wait wa
k
eups
Signed-off-by:
Emilio G. Cota
<cota@braap.org>
commit
|
commitdiff
|
tree
2015-05-08
E
milio G
.
Cota
config
u
re:
requ
i
re __thr
e
ad
s
upport
Signed-off-by:
Emilio G. Cota
<cota@braap.org>
commit
|
commitdiff
|
tree
2015-05-05
Emilio G
.
Cota
tcg: optimi
s
e me
m
ory lay
o
ut of TCGTe
m
p
Signed-off-by:
Emilio G. Cota
<cota@braap.org>
commit
|
commitdiff
|
tree
2015-04-30
Emilio
G
.
Cota
l
inux-user/e
l
fload: use
QTAILQ_FOREACH
inste
a
d of open
.
.
.
Signed-off-by:
Emilio G. Cota
<cota@braap.org>
commit
|
commitdiff
|
tree
2015-04-30
E
m
il
i
o G
.
Co
t
a
corout
i
ne: remo
v
e unnecessa
r
y
parentheses
i
n qemu_c
o
_queue
_
empty
Signed-off-by:
Emilio G. Cota
<cota@braap.org>
commit
|
commitdiff
|
tree
2015-04-30
Em
i
lio G
.
Cota
qemu-char: r
e
move unuse
d
list node from FDCh
a
rDri
v
er
Signed-off-by:
Emilio G. Cota
<cota@braap.org>
commit
|
commitdiff
|
tree
2015-04-30
Emilio G
.
Cota
input: rem
o
ve un
u
s
e
d
mouse
_
handlers list
Signed-off-by:
Emilio G. Cota
<cota@braap.org>
commit
|
commitdiff
|
tree
2015-04-30
Emilio G
.
Cota
cpus: use first_c
p
u macro instead o
f
QTAILQ_FIRST(
.
.
.
Signed-off-by:
Emilio G. Cota
<cota@braap.org>
commit
|
commitdiff
|
tree
2015-04-28
Emilio G
.
C
ota
t
r
anslate-a
l
l
: use b
i
tmap helpers fo
r
PageDes
c
's bitmap
Signed-off-by:
Emilio G. Cota
<cota@braap.org>
commit
|
commitdiff
|
tree
2015-04-27
Emilio G
.
Cota
translate-al
l
: us
e
glib fo
r
all page descriptor allocatio
n
s
Signed-off-by:
Emilio G. Cota
<cota@braap.org>
commit
|
commitdiff
|
tree
2015-04-04
Emilio G
.
Co
t
a
t
a
rget-i386: remo
v
e s
u
per
f
luous
TARGET_H
A
S_SMC macr
o
Signed-off-by:
Emilio G. Cota
<cota@braap.org>
commit
|
commitdiff
|
tree